HUAWEI Mate 10 Users can Unlock Phones with Their Face

Continuing HUAWEI’s commitment to introduce meaningful innovation and industry-leading products to consumers around the world, HUAWEI Malaysia has announced an exciting new software update for all HUAWEI Mate 10 Series users. Packaged together in the new update is the facial recognition technology that enabled “Face Unlock” for HUAWEI Mate 10 series users, set to arrive in Malaysia on 25 May 2018. Customers will be notified of the updates in batches begin upon the arrival date.

Sticking to its image as a consumer-friendly product, HUAWEI Mate 10 Series Face Unlock feature also includes two other options: 1) Direct unlock or 2) Slide to unlock.

The former works best as it allows users to unlock the device using minimum effort. On the other hand, the latter option takes it a step further by synergizing with the “Smart Lock Screen Notifications”. When enable, the device blocks all notifications from being viewed unless the device itself is unlocked. Putting our customer’s satisfaction as a number one priority, HUAWEI has taken a unique approach to ensure maximum protection along the way. Simply follow the steps below to enable the “Face Unlock” feature:

  1. Go to Settings > Security & privacy > Face unlock
  2. First time users will be given a brief introduction to Face Unlock, and tips to speed up face enrolment.
  3. Users must read and accept the disclaimer before proceeding.
  4. Users may now enroll their face following on-screen prompts.
  5. After creating a facial profile, users may choose between two modes: Direct unlock and Slide to unlock.
  6. Face unlock setup is now complete.
